First game was against fluffy tyranids with 2 Flyrants, a few stealers, 6 zoeys, mawlock and lots of hormagaunts.<br />On first turn we lashed hormies and killed them right out with stealers with no wounds back.<br />On second turn we repeated that with flyrant.<br />The game ended on turn 3 with a tie, because we ran out of time. If we had one more turn we could make a wipeout on turn 4:)<br /><br />2. Second game against orcs+orcs on wagons w/bikers. Dice were really bad. We won roll-off and deployed aggressively, but then orcs stealed the initiative. On our turn 1, 3 zoeys, oblits and havocs did nothing to the closest battlewagon, but lashed nobs on bikes were cut down by stealers. In two turns orcs almost wiped us out, but outflanking stealers killed lootas on the marker and we tied on mission. The result is a tie.<br /><br />3. Game 3 was against CSM on landraider + platoon IG. I managed a first turn charge and small genestealer brood wiped out a 30-man squad of IG in 2 phases. Zoeys stopped LandRaider while large genestealers brood engaged CSM troops in preparation to assault last IG platoon. Opponents gived up on turn 2.<br /><br />So, we received a bit of team-tourney experience and going to participate this year too, cause it was a lot of fun:)Erlehttps://www.blogger.com/profile/03093689673521332325no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4260829252124595446.post-10464716516289604312011-03-31T11:54:06.233-04:002011-03-31T11:54:06.233-04:00Ok, I'll talk with my partner about this.

So only 3 oblits in 1 squad.Erlehttps://www.blogger.com/profile/03093689673521332325no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4260829252124595446.post-4253907510550028802011-03-31T08:11:50.527-04:002011-03-31T08:11:50.527-04:00Depending if your friend wants to really up the ch...Depending if your friend wants to really up the cheese factor, he could go with the Lash Prince & Lash Sorcerer. By dropping the dread, adding 2X2 Oblits w/ the Vindicator, he'd also up his vehicle popping ability. Tactic wise, pop the other teams transports, Lash the guys inside towards your close combat hitters, and you'll be entrenched in your opponent's deployment zone by turn 2. <br /><br />In terms of a small comment on his list, instead of putting a combi melta on the rhino or on the champ, give a regular dude in the squad the melta. You'll still be able to fire out of the top hatch, and it's not a one shot wonder. It also costs the same pointswise.Crispyh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/15375051330599916521no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4260829252124595446.post-34255991738592508872011-03-30T23:38:26.904-04:002011-03-30T23:38:26.904-04:00It's kinda funny- I love the NOVA format an...It's kinda funny- I love the NOVA format an' all, but the 4 way event from last week's posts and now a discussion regarding a Team Tourney kinda has me missing these sorta things...SinSynnh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/12352693991857976930no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4260829252124595446.post-45912224873000789512011-03-30T02:50:44.619-04:002011-03-30T02:50:44.619-04:00I awaited the words “play aggressively and deploy ...I awaited the words “play aggressively and deploy everything” :) I see how it work and I like the list.
